One of the most common inquiries revolves around survival rates—what they mean, how accurate they are, and how they can influence treatment choices. These statistics are typically expressed as percentages, indicating the proportion of people who survive a certain period after diagnosis, often five years. However, it’s essential to recognize that these numbers are averages and cannot predict individual outcomes precisely.
Many ask whether early detection improves survival rates. The answer is a resounding yes. Detecting cancer early, before symptoms appear or while it is localized, significantly enhances the chances of successful treatment and long-term survival. Screening methods such as mammograms for breast cancer, colonoscopies for colorectal cancer, and Pap smears for cervical cancer are vital tools in catching the disease at its most treatable stages. Consequently, public health campaigns emphasize regular screenings, especially for high-risk groups, to improve survival prospects.
Questions about prevention are equally prevalent. People want to know what lifestyle choices can reduce their risk of developing cancer. While not all cancers are preventable, several modifiable factors can lower risk. Maintaining a healthy weight, engaging in regular physical activity, avoiding tobacco, limiting alcohol consumption, and consuming a balanced diet rich in fruits and vegetables are well-documented strategies. Additionally, vaccination against certain cancer-causing viruses, such as HPV and hepatitis B, has proven effective in reducing incidences of related cancers.

Another common concern pertains to the role of genetics versus environment. Some individuals wonder how much their family history influences their chances of developing cancer and whether genetic testing can provide clearer insights. Genetic predispositions can indeed increase risk for specific types of cancer, like BRCA mutations linked to breast and ovarian cancers. However, having a genetic mutation does not guarantee the development of cancer, and lifestyle factors remain crucial. Genetic counseling can help individuals understand their risk and guide preventive measures.
Treatment advances have also raised questions about survival improvements over time. Modern therapies, including targeted treatments, immunotherapy, and personalized medicine, have dramatically increased survival rates for certain cancers. For example, certain types of leukemia and melanoma now have significantly higher five-year survival percentages compared to decades ago. Nevertheless, outcomes vary widely depending on cancer type, stage at diagnosis, and overall health.
